NTSB Narrative Summary Released at Completion of Accident

The pilot attempted to land on a gravel airstrip with approximately 4 inches of snow cover. A previous flight had successfully landed at the airstrip in an identical aircraft (except with larger tires) but indicated that the snow was 'a definite factor' for landing. The pilot reported that on his landing attempt, the airplane '...sank in which caused a bounce. I...did not add power to smooth the bounce or go around.' Following the bounce, the aircraft touched down in unbroken snow and immediately nosed over.

NTSB Probable Cause Narrative

The pilot's inadequate recovery from a bounced landing. The snow-covered landing surface and the pilot's decision not to perform a go-around were factors.
